Overview

Postcode CB5 8UP is located in an urban city, within the Fen Ditton & Fulbourn ward of South Cambridgeshire in the East of England region, and forms part of the Milton, Fen Ditton & Quy area. It has low de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 115.5 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, roughly 1.4× the East of England average of 82 per 1,000. The average income per household in Milton, Fen Ditton & Quy is £75,979 per year. The nearest station is Cambridge North, about 0.5 miles away. There are 3 primary and no secondary schools in the area. There are 3 parks nearby, the closest large park is Ditton Meadows.

Property prices in Fen Ditton & Fulbourn

Median price£470,000
Price per sq ft£475
Sales (last 12 months)113
Typical range (middle 50%)£370K – £605K

Based on 113 recent sales, the median property price is £470,000 (about £475 per square foot) in Fen Ditton & Fulbourn area, with individual transactions ranging from £190,000 up to £1,850,000.
